About KOKUBU
KOKUBU was founded when Kanbei Kokubu IV opened the retail store “Daikokuya” in Edo Nihonbashi.
As a food wholesaler, we deliver foods across all of Japan.
Responding to needs that change with the times, we have shaped new ways of food distribution thanks to our wealth of product knowledge and proposal capabilities. KOKUBU’s strengths lie in our reliability and flexibility, reinforced by our long history.
KOKUBU key figures
Established in
1712
Kanbei Kokubu IV, borned in Izawa where was the southern area of Ise-matsusaka, started the business in Edo-Nihonbashi since 1712. It is recorded that he was dealing with the Kimono trade as well as started the soy sauce brewing operation at the period of establishment. In the early Meiji period, it converted to a foodstuff-wholesaling while withdrawing from the soy sauce brewing industry.
KOKUBU Group
59Companies
KOKUBU Group is formed by domestic and overseas 39 subsidiaries and 20 associate companies.
Product Line-up
600,000Items
The number of product line-up is about 600,000 items, such as processed foods, alcoholic drinks, confectionery, frozen chilled and fresh food, etc.
Distribution Centers
328Locations (Domestic)
The logistics network covering the whole dometic area is built up by 328-location distribution centers. Also we have logistics functions in China and the ASEAN.
Export to
62Countries
Currently, we export foods and alcoholic drinks to 62 countries, mainly Asia, Europe and North America.
Annual Sales
2,243.1Billion
The KOKUBU Group's annual sales for the fiscal year ended December 2025 was JPY 2,243.1 billions.
Our Customers
35,000Companies
We have dealings with about 35,000 companies, including supermarkets, convenience stores, department stores, drug stores, liquor shops, food-service and meal-supplying, mail-order and net trade, etc.
Our Clients
10,000Companies
We have business with about 10,000 manufacturers to meet the needs of our customers.
